Symptoms of Failure
- Erratic or delayed shifting under load: Worn clutch packs inside the assembly cause hesitation or harsh engagement, especially when moving from forward to reverse.
- Low hydraulic pressure and overheating: Internal seal degradation leads to pressure loss, resulting in transmission slippage and elevated oil temperatures during operation.
- Metallic debris in the oil pan: As gears and bearings wear, fine metal particles contaminate the hydraulic fluid, often accompanied by a whining noise from the gear train.
- Complete loss of forward or reverse drive: A catastrophic failure of the planetary gear set or torque converter hub renders the unit inoperable, requiring immediate replacement of the entire assembly.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Can the 4656.054.170 assembly be rebuilt, or must it be replaced as a complete unit?
A: While individual clutch packs and seals can be serviced, this complete unit is typically replaced when internal wear is extensive. Rebuilding requires specialized tooling for gear train shimming and hydraulic pressure calibration.
Q: What is the typical lifespan of this powershift transmission assembly under normal operating conditions?
A: With proper fluid maintenance and load management, the ZF 4 WG 160 assembly often lasts 8,000 to 12,000 operating hours before major overhaul is needed. Harsh environments with heavy dust or frequent direction changes may reduce this interval.
Q: Does this unit include the torque converter, or is that sold separately?
A: The 4656.054.170 is a complete transmission assembly that includes the integrated torque converter. However, the flywheel housing and flex plate are not included and must be ordered separately if damaged.
